In 2016, two commuter trains collided head-on at Bad Aibling in southeastern Germany, killing 12 people and injuring 85 in one of the country's deadliest railway accidents in recent history. Earlier, in 1996, researchers at the GSI Helmholtz Centre for Heavy Ion Research in Darmstadt, Germany, achieved a notable breakthrough in nuclear science by first creating the chemical element copernicium, expanding the periodic table with a new synthetic element.

What the Weather Had in Store for Munich on 9th February 1953

Snow

Sunrise 08:30
Sunset 18:25
Sunshine duration 02:00 hours
Daylight duration 09:54 hours

Maximum temperature -0.4°C
Minimum temperature -16.8°C

Wind speed 29km/h from SW
Precipitation 2.6mm
Snowfall 1.82cm
